Lots of good gyms in chch.

Eastside barbell is home to many powerlifters and bbers. Good range equipment to get the job done. Squat racks and benches are plentiful. The owner is a abit dodgy tho :pfft:

Fitness Canterbury gets a good rep and produces some monsters. Never been their but heard good things.

im sure there are others but those two should def be considered

Now, now chemo Snap is still a step up on Jetts. At least they have free weights, now I know the ChCh Snaps arent great, but I train at the one in Wellington and it does the job for now, they've got a couple of power racks and dumbbells go up to 45's which isn't too bad. Space for deadlifts and olympic lifting too. Leg press can take 12 plates a side. For a 24 hour gym i'm pretty happy with it.

As for ChCh I'd say Fitness Canterbury or Eastside. Try them out and see which suits you better. Personally I'd go with Eastside, but then again what do I know I train at a Snap. \:D/
